Top 5 Character Collection Games in Nigeria Q4 2024
Explore the performance trends of top character collection games in Nigeria during Q4 2024, with insights from Sensor Tower.
In the fourth quarter of 2024, character collection games continued to captivate players in Nigeria. Here's a look at the top five games on a unified platform, according to Sensor Tower data.
Free Fire x NARUTO SHIPPUDEN from Garena International I saw a notable increase in weekly revenue, peaking at around $36K in late December. Weekly downloads surged to approximately 41.9K in early December, while active users climbed steadily from 290K to 474K over the quarter.
eFootball™ by KONAMI experienced fluctuations in revenue, peaking at about $32K in late November. Downloads remained stable, with a high of 18.3K in early December. Active users hovered around 375K initially, reaching over 414K by the end of December.
Limbus Company from Project Moon showed a moderate revenue increase, reaching $15K in late November. The game maintained a small but consistent active user base, ending the quarter with 42 users.
Captain Tsubasa: Dream Team by KLab had a revenue peak of $15.9K at the end of December. Downloads saw a significant boost mid-quarter, reaching 2.4K in mid-November, while active users increased from 225 to 748.
CookieRun: Kingdom by Devsisters Corporation experienced a revenue peak of $18.1K at the start of the quarter. Downloads remained low, with a high of 50 in late September, and active users fluctuated slightly, ending at 89.
